Malta Erupts in Outrage After Businessman Acquitted in Journalist’s Murder Trial

Widespread protests have erupted in Malta following the acquittal of businessman Yorgen Fenech, who was charged with ordering the 2017 assassination of investigative journalist Daphne Caruana Galizia. Human rights groups and opposition leaders condemned the verdict as a setback for press freedom and judicial accountability.

CPJ Urges EU to Support Media Freedom Reform in Hungary

The Committee to Protect Journalists (CPJ) has called on the European Union to support media freedom reforms in Hungary, stating that the 'takeover of the Hungarian media landscape by Orbán has turned much of the press into de facto propaganda mouthpieces for the Fidesz party.'

CPJ Urges US to Complete Shireen Abu Akleh Death Probe

The Committee to Protect Journalists (CPJ) has called on the United States to finalize its investigation into the 2022 killing of journalist Shireen Abu Akleh. Abu Akleh died from Israeli soldier fire, and the CPJ seeks a full resolution to the inquiry.

Kenyan Journalist Escapes Abduction After Criticizing President

A Kenyan journalist reportedly escaped an abduction attempt following his criticism of the president, according to the Committee to Protect Journalists (CPJ). This incident raises concerns about press freedom and the safety of journalists in Kenya.

Dozens of Palestinian journalists beaten, starved or raped, report alleges

Israeli prison service and IDF reject allegations after research by Committee to Protect Journalists Almost 60 Palestinian journalists detained in Israeli prisons since the 7 October 2023 Hamas attack have been beaten, starved and subjected to sexual violence, including rape, a report alleges. The Committee to Protect Journalists (CPJ) reviewed dozens of testimonies, photographs and medical records documenting what it describes as serious abuses by Israeli soldiers and prison guards against Palestinian reporters. The report draws on in-depth interviews from 59 Palestinian journalists. Of those interviewed, 58 reported being subjected to what they described as torture while in Israeli custody.
